The Kennedale Board of Adjustment on Oct. 27 approved a variance to reduce the minimum rear yard setback from 20 feet to 5 feet and to reduce the minimum side-yard setback from 50 feet to 5 feet at 600 West Kennedale Parkway, a parcel owned by the Kennedale Economic Development Corporation.

The request was presented by Mr. Hall, a representative of the city and the Kennedale Economic Development Corporation. "The Economic Development Corporation currently owns that property at 600 West Kennedale Parkway," he said.
